R Madhavan alerts fans about fake social media account

"NO other account either represents me nor speaks on my behalf on Instagram or any social media," the actor wrote.

Actor R Madhavan took to Instagram to flag a fake profile impersonating him.

 

Sharing a screenshot of the fake handle on Saturday, the “Dhurandhar” star warned his fans that appropriate action is being taken. He explicitly stated that this account is unauthorised and reminded his followers that he maintains no other profiles that speak or act on his behalf.

 

He mentioned the username of the fake account in his caption. "FRAUD ALLERT … THIS PERSON IS NOT CONNECTED TO ME OR MY TEAM IN ANY WAY. THEY CLAIM TO PRESENT ME AND SPEAK TO PEOPLE ON THE I SOCIAL MEDIA ON MY BEHALF. THIS IS TOTALLY A FRAUD ACCOUNT KINDLY BE AWARE," he wrote.

"NO other account either represents me nor speaks on my behalf on Instagram or any social media. PLS NOTE AND BE AWARE.. Appropriate steps are being taken to hold this person accountable," he added.

 

On the work front, Madhavan will be seen next in "Dhurandhar 2: The Revenge", which is set to release in theatres on March 19. Directed by Aditya Dhar, the film is a sequel to "Dhurandhar" and features the actor in the role of the Director of the Intelligence Bureau (IB), Ajay Sanyal.
